Output 34ee2c830c8bf44e00340863b19c62c6f150bd97869cf19ee0624602d434b6f4:18

value
75940000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1cbcdb7fda6f90b69f9a81b1b7e924d54c42f3 OP_EQUALVERIFY OP_CHECKSIG
address
1MFRSKUEuhYsAHHjmefCRTA6Kox8oFPfMV
transaction
34ee2c830c8bf44e00340863b19c62c6f150bd97869cf19ee0624602d434b6f4
spent
true